How much do software sales man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 31, 2026, the average yearly pay for software sales manager in California is $109,232.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$76,500.00 and $145,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a Software Sales Manager typically collaborate with product and technical teams to drive sales?

As a Software Sales Manager, close collaboration with product and technical teams is essential to understand the software's features, roadmap, and technical limitations. Regular meetings and feedback sessions help ensure that sales strategies align with product development and customer needs. By working together, the sales manager can relay client feedback and market trends to the technical team, enabling timely enhancements and tailored solutions. This partnership not only fosters stronger customer relationships but also helps in crafting compelling value propositions during the sales process.

What does a Software Sales Manager do?

A Software Sales Manager is responsible for leading a team of sales professionals who sell software products and solutions to clients. Their duties include developing sales strategies, setting targets, building client relationships, and overseeing the entire sales process. They also analyze market trends, identify new business opportunities, and ensure their team meets or exceeds sales goals. Additionally, they often collaborate with product development and marketing teams to align offerings with customer needs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Software Sales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Software Sales Manager, you need a strong background in sales strategy, client relationship management, and a solid understanding of software products, usually supported by a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M systems like Salesforce, sales analytics tools, and sometimes relevant sales certifications are typically required. Exceptional communication, negotiation, leadership, and problem-solving skills help you motivate teams and build lasting client partnerships. These competencies are crucial for driving revenue growth, meeting sales targets, and maintaining a competitive edge in the fast-evolving software industry.

What is the difference between Software Sales Manager vs Software Account Executive?

AspectSoftware Sales ManagerSoftware Account Executive
Primary RoleOversees sales teams, develops strategies, manages client relationshipsGenerates new sales, manages individual client accounts
Required CredentialsTypically requires sales experience, industry knowledge, sometimes management trainingSales experience, product knowledge, communication skills
Work EnvironmentTeam management, strategic planning, client meetingsClient interactions, sales presentations, prospecting
Industry UsageCommon in tech companies, SaaS providers, enterprise software firmsCommon in software companies, SaaS, tech startups

The main difference is that a Software Sales Manager leads sales teams and develops strategies, while a Software Account Executive focuses on closing deals and managing individual client accounts. Both roles require sales skills and industry knowledge but differ in scope and responsibilities.
